  • I don't know about the plane ride, but for the hotel room we always rearrange it. I move anything on the counter or table into the closet if possible. I also move tables and chairs so he can't climb on stuff as easy. I have found that most outlets are hidden behind furniture, but I still bring some outlet covers just in case. Have fun on your trip!   • G was about the same age as your LO when we went to San Diego last year.  I bought a bunch of books and toys from the dollar bins at Target and loaded them up the the diaper bag.  I also packed a TON of snacks, including treats I wouldn't normally give him to snack on (like Oreos).  Between the toys and snacks, I was able to keep him entertained.

    On the flight down we had a short layover.  I typically like to fly direct, but the layover was a life saver!  Being able to get out of the plane, walk around, and have a change of scenery made the trip down SO much easier than the flight back, which was direct.

  • For the plane: a magnadoodle, crayons & stickers with a coloring book, and gel window clings (check the seasonal aisle at Target) were the biggest hits.  We stocked up on those fruit/veggie puree pouches (Ella's, Plum Organics or HappyTot) and cereal bar type things.  And I second hitting the Target $1 aisle.
  • When watching movies the plane is too noisy to hear anything without head phones. We have a pair of those giant Bose ones that Ella wears. At first, I had to hold them on her head, with the ear parts next to her ear, not touching. Then she got used to it and is fine wearing them now.

  • I bring outlet covers and a night light. Oh and a sound machine. Masking tape is a great idea. You might at least slow down progress on opening cupboards or drawers. And just move things up high. An bring a bunch ohms antibacterial wipes to scrub everything down like the door knobs, drawer pulls, tv remote, phones. All of thode things that don't get cleaned. Have fun!!
